A pharmacy technician opportunity is available for a contract assignment at a Long-Term Acute Care (LTAC) and rehabilitation hospital setting located in Muskogee, OK. This role offers an ASAP start and a 13-week duration with potential to convert to a permanent position.
Responsibilities include:
- Performing inpatient pharmacy duties such as sterile and non-sterile compounding
- Restocking and managing automated dispensing systems (Pyxis units)
- Fielding phone calls into the pharmacy and supporting clinical staff needs
- Supporting medication distribution and inventory control within the hospital pharmacy setting
Qualifications and Desired Experience:
- Previous hospital pharmacy technician experience is required
- Current Oklahoma pharmacy technician license, or willingness to obtain promptly
- Knowledge of sterile compounding procedures and inpatient pharmacy operations
- Strong organizational skills and ability to work efficiently during day shifts
Schedule and Location:
- Day shifts, 8 hours per shift
- Based in Muskogee, OK, within a LTAC/Rehab hospital environment
